Vegan Sweet Potato Lentil Soup Recipe

This soup features tender sweet potatoes and lentils simmered in a flavorful broth with aromatic spices. The recipe takes about 45 minutes from start to finish and serves 6 people.

Ingredients

  • 2 medium sweet potatoes, peeled and diced
  • 1 cup dried green or brown lentils, rinsed
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 carrots, diced
  • 1 celery stalk, diced
  • 6 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Fresh cilantro or parsley for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prep the Ingredients: Peel and dice the sweet potatoes, chop the onion, carrots, and celery, and mince the garlic.
  2. Sauté Aromatics: In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ion, carrots, and celery, and sauté until softened (about 5-7 minutes).
  3. Add Garlic and Spices: Stir in the minced garlic, cumin, and smoked paprika, cooking for another minute until fragrant.
  4. Combine Ingredients: Add the diced sweet potatoes, lentils, and vegetable broth to the pot. Bring to a boil.
  5. Simmer: Reduce the heat to low and let the soup simmer for about 25-30 minutes, or until the lentils and sweet potatoes are tender.
  6. Season and Serve: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ro or parsley if desired.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Nutrition Information

  • Servings: 6 bowls
  • Calories: 180kcal
  • Fat: 5g
  • Protein: 8g
  • Carbohydrates: 30g
